Google Ads for Small Business: Beginner-Friendly Setup Guide

2026-03-311 min read

Start with one clear objective: lead generation, calls or purchases. Avoid running mixed goals in one campaign at the beginning.

Build tightly themed ad groups with intent-based keywords and matching landing pages. Relevance lowers wasted spend.

Set up conversion tracking before launch. Without conversion data, optimization decisions become guesses.

Use negative keywords weekly to reduce irrelevant clicks and improve cost per qualified lead.

Scale only after you reach stable conversion quality and profitable acquisition cost.
